The stage is set for an exciting Europa League last-16 clash as Manchester United lock horns with Spanish side Real Sociedad. Erik ten Hag’s men will be looking to keep their European hopes alive, but they face a tricky test against a Sociedad side known for their disciplined play and tactical prowess.

Meanwhile, Tottenham have been drawn against Dutch outfit AZ Alkmaar, setting up a high-intensity battle, while Rangers face a blockbuster encounter with Jose Mourinho’s Fenerbahce.

If United advance, they will go head-to-head with either Romanian giants FCSB or French club Lyon in the quarter-finals. Spurs, on the other hand, could face either Eintracht Frankfurt or Ajax if they progress. Rangers will have to navigate past Roma or Athletic Bilbao should they get through their Turkish test.

The first legs are scheduled for Thursday, 6 March, with the return fixtures taking place a week later on 13 March.

Full Europa League Last-16 Fixtures:

  • Bodo/Glimt vs Olympiakos
  • Fenerbahce vs Rangers
  • Ajax vs Eintracht Frankfurt
  • FCSB vs Lyon
  • AZ Alkmaar vs Tottenham
  • Real Sociedad vs Manchester United
  • Viktoria Plzen vs Lazio

The road to Europa League glory is heating up, and with plenty of heavyweight clashes on the horizon, the knockout phase promises to deliver high drama and intense competition.
